00:40keep things brief so let's dive in. First up on the list is none other than quarterback Will Greer.
00:47The reason why he's on the list is very simple. Cooper Rush is gone to the Baltimore Ravens.
00:52Trey Lance is very unlikely to come back so the Cowboys are likely going to pick somebody
00:57in the NFL draft. The thing is they have to do it before Will Greer is demoted. In other words
01:03Greer is Dak Prescott's backup until proven otherwise. Number two on the list give me
01:09Kaitlin Carson. Second year rookie cornerback that started in week one as De'Aaron Bland's
01:14replacement and he might start again next year. The reason why is simple. Trevon Dix is hurt and
01:21the Cowboys lost Jordan Lewis in free agency. In other words there is one more spot that's wide
01:26open for players like Carson to take over and I think Carson is going to be a favorite just because
01:32he did decent as a rookie and was always looked at as a developmental player. The thing about
01:38Carson is he can play inside and outside and it just feels like there's going to be a spot for
01:42the taking for him. Seatbelt is the nickname for Kaitlin and it's time for him to buckle up. Number
01:47three and four on the list these go hand in hand. I'm taking offensive tackles Tyler Guyton and
01:53Terrence Steele. It didn't really seem like the Cowboys were in the market to upgrade at offensive
01:58tackle but there were some solid options in the market if they really wanted to be aggressive.
02:04Spearheaded by Ronnie Stanley you also had Dan Moore and other players that could have been
02:09looked at as improvements from what the Cowboys have but the Cowboys passed on all of them. They
02:14did sign offensive line but that was Rob Jones. He's likely going to be a backed up on the inside
02:20so Tyler Guyton and Terrence Steele not threatened so far by the Cowboys decisions. Next up on the
02:26list is Jalen Tolbert. Jalen hasn't really been the fan's favorite so far and there are legit
02:33question marks to whether or not he is deserving of being a number three wide receiver in the league
02:39and being completely honest with you it feels like wide receiver two is completely out of the
02:44question for him. Now for that to happen though the Cowboys need somebody because the Cowboys don't
02:50have a starter in their lineup beyond CeeDee Lamb just yet at least not a clear-cut one. So if the
02:57Cowboys had to play a game today Tolbert would likely be at least number three in that lineup
03:03if not number two. So since the Cowboys did not sign a starting caliber wide receiver or haven't
03:09done so yet at least Amari Cooper is still out there. Stephon Diggs is still out there then Jalen
03:15Tolbert is on the winner's list because it feels like there is a spot waiting for him but this
03:20might be just temporary because I still believe the Cowboys got to upgrade at a wide receiver and as
03:25an additional note the Cowboys did sign veteran Paris Campbell but he might be closer to being a
03:32roster bubble guy than he is someone with a legit crack at a starting lineup spot. Next up on the
03:38list is none other than Oza Odigisua. Now keep in mind he's not on the list because of his 80
03:44million dollar deal this video is about players benefiting from other decisions across the roster
03:50but they got him a backup a legitimate backup in Solomon Thomas a three technique that was once
03:56the number three overall pick in the NFL. Listen Solomon Thomas is not going to be a game changer
04:01for the Cowboys defense but he will allow Oza's legs to stay fresh that's been an issue for
04:07Odigisua over the last few years and it's mostly been a roster issue for the Cowboys. Oza is not
04:12particularly the biggest defensive tackle in the league so if he can stay fresh he's only going to
04:18be more dangerous for the Cowboys. I think he's a big winner after the Cowboys brought in Solomon
04:24Thomas and finally linebacker the Marvian Overshone. The reason why Overshone is on the list is it's
04:32true the Cowboys brought in some competition at linebacker in Jack Sanborn and then they also
04:37added Kenneth Murray via a trade but I ultimately see this as an opportunity for Overshone to take
04:44his time. We know he's fighting back from injury and honestly the Cowboys out of necessity might
04:50have been tempted to rush him back onto the field in September because they don't have or they didn't
04:56have enough linebacker depth but adding Sanborn and adding Murray and potentially another linebacker
05:02even if it's in day three of the NFL draft that will give Overshone some additional opportunity
05:08to come back take his time and come back when he really should instead of the Cowboys rushing him
05:14back onto the field. We saw the Cowboys try to do that with Bland last year did not work out for
05:19them he re-injured his foot hopefully none of that happens with Overshone and it feels to me that
05:25adding some depth at the position will only help his case. So those are seven winners from the
